Chile Green Beans

Red and green make this a festive dish. It can be a hot as you wish. . just add more chilli. The chicken stock can be replaced with a vegetable sauce for a vegetarian dish. Show more

Ready In: 50 mins

Serves: 4

Ingredients

  • 2  tablespoons  oil
  • 2  onions, thickly sliced
  • 1  teaspoon chili powder
  • 1  tablespoon flour
  • 1  cup  chicken stock or 1  cup water
  • 1  lb green beans, trimmed and cut
  • 1  red pepper, seeded and sliced
  • 1  teaspoon tomato paste
  •  salt and pepper
  • 4  small tomatoes, peeled and quartered

Directions

  1. Heat oil in saucepan or wok.
  2. Add onions and fry until softened, about 8 minutes.
  3. Add chilli powder and flour.
  4. Cook stirring for 2 minutes.
  5. Gradually add stock stirring until smooth.
  6. Add beans, pepper and tomato paste.
  7. Lower heat and simmer 15 minutes.
  8. Season to taste.
  9. Add tomatoes and cook another 3 minutes.
